Rucking Machine This machine is designed to reduce the labour costs associated with filling the cones for mesh baggers with mesh. The cone is placed on the platform, the rucking wheels are engaged and the machine is turned on. There are adjustable weights on the back of the machine that determine how tight or loosely the mesh is installed on the cone. Once the cone is full the machine automatically turns off. |

Basic Carrot Cutter This economical cutter was designed for the smaller grower/processor. The carrots are fed onto the feed in tray with a conveyor while 1 or 2 people orient and align the carrots into the flights with the butts facing out. The carrots are then fed through the blades cutting them into whatever size the customer desires. The butts are discarded out the side chutes and the cut pieces are separated on the discharge end according to each individual customers requirements. |

Top & Tailer Carrot Cutter This cutter is ideal for a medium sized grower/processor. The production capacity of this machine is similar to the Basic Cutter; however, no people are required to orient and align the carrots into the flights. The carrots are slid over to one side where the tip/butt is cut off, then tilted the opposite way and slid over to the other side where the tip/but is cut off the other end. The butt/tip is discarded out the side while the remaining carrot is cut into 2" or 4" lengths and discharged off the end. |

Spinach Packing Machines This automatic weighing & packing machine is a good example of a job where we worked closely with the customer to develop the machine he had in mind. When this machine was fabricated the customer came to us with a design for two custom spinach-packing machines to suit his specific application. He had basic drawings of what he was looking for and was closely involved through the entire project while they were fabricated and tested. This machine was designed to pack spinach and ice into a newly developed plastic container that was now becoming standard for the spinach industry. The spinach was weighed in batches of 12 lbs, each batch was released into an empty bin at the bottom of the packing machine. The spinach was then compressed with a plunger and then indexed automatically to the next position where 10lbs of crushed ice was discharged onto the spinach. The box would again automatically index to a third position where again 12lbs of spinach was released onto the ice. A second plunger would then compress the spinach again and hold it down while the box was ejected from the indexing conveyor, the lid was closed and the full box was taken away. All functions of this machine are controlled by a PLC with amazing flexibility for timing adjustments. |
